Salaries of Stale Employes
North Carolina’s public servants
aren’t doing so badly, so
Гаг
as income
is concerned. Since 1949, the salaries
paid officials and employes have in¬
creased anywhere from 60 per cent to
165 per cent. In those 15 years, cost of
living has risen tremendously, too. and
in some cases the increase in salaries
has not kepi pace with increased ex¬
penses.
Still and all. the President of the
UNC gets 525.000 a year— the same as
the governor and while by present
standards this isn’t a rich man's income,
it is substantial when compared with
income of the average North Caro¬
linian on private payroll.
Under him are a string of employes
making from SI 5.000 to $20.000 a
year. The following table shows the
salaries fixed by the governor and the
advisory budget commission.
Most of these employes received an
increase Sept. I. 1963. but a few have
not had increases in several years, go¬
ing back to 1959. Also, a few increases
were made on Jan. I. 1964.
It should be noted that these figures
are as of Jan. I. 1964. Since then, sev¬
eral increases have been given. The
UNC president has been raised to $25.-
000. and the Wildlife Commission head
has been raised from $12.500 to $15.-
000. for example. The university chan¬
cellors were upped by $3.000 and now
make $23.000. However, we decided to
use the official Jan. I. 1964. figures
rather than try to make spotty correc¬
tions.

Some Smaller Salaries
I he table below gives salaries of
classified slate employes in 1949, in
1964, increase in dollars, and percent¬
age of increase.
The figures indicate there are some
fairly lucrative jobs for career people
in state government.
